In a food … Aioli, allioli or aïoli is a cold sauce consisting of an emulsion of garlic and olive oil; it is found in the cuisines of the northwest Mediterranean, from Andalusia to Calabria. The names mean "garlic and oil" in Catalan and Provençal. Webai·o·li (ā-ō′lē, ī-ō′-) n. A rich sauce of crushed garlic, egg yolks, lemon juice, and olive oil. [Provençal : ai, garlic (from Latin allium; see allium) + oli, oil (from Latin oleum; see oil ).] American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fifth Edition.
